Ordinals
beta
Address bc1qs2uj2heqpjvrhm3vj676t99vceqckfhpxcqg3p
sat balance
223637
outputs
846f2d33e906d7f42d6db7ffba83dfe8816d540d2a0f74c8eeaae1735c1a091e:0